505 Kg Of Ganja Worth Rs 50 Lakh Seized In Odisha’s Koraput In Pre-Poll Crackdown

Koraput: Police on Thursday seized 505 kg of ganja worth over Rs 50 lakh near Hanumal village under Machhakunda police limits in Odisha’s Koraput.

Acting on a tiff, Machhakunda police conducted a raid in a cashew jungle near Hanumal village in Machhakunda and seized ganja packed in 15 polythene bags. However, they were unable to apprehend the ganja mafias as the miscreants managed to escape.

According to police sources, the ganjas weighed 505 kg and 200 grams and the estimated value of the contraband would be Rs 50 lakh.

An investigation has been started.

In another incident in Kuchinda of Odisha’s Sambalpur, a police flying squad seized Rs 5 lakh from a scooter-borne man near the old bus stand of the town. The man was not able to give a satisfactory reply to the police when asked about the source of the cash. He has also been detained.

To check illegal cash movement ahead of the elections, Odisha police have intensified checking of vehicles, especially in the districts bordering other states.
